What makes the magic numbers?
The answer is SPIN-ORBIT coupling energy. This
term was much bigger than had been expected. It
was discovered in 1949 independently by two
research groups.
Maria Goeppert Mayer (1906 1972)
J. Hans D. Jensen (1907 1973)
(with Haxel and Suess)
1963 Nobel Laureates

Borrowing from Atomic Physics
In atomic physics the splitting of the p and d
levels is known as FINE STRUCTURE. This FINE
STRUCTURE is produced by SPIN-ORBIT coupling. In
the H spectrum the size of the SPIN ORBIT
SPLITTING is 10-4 eV which is very small compared
to the gross structure on the 10eV scale. Let us
look at what is causing this splitting in more
detail.

Spin-Orbit Coupling is general
Although derived for Atomic Physics, this
equation for the spin orbit coupling energy is in
fact quite GENERAL. It applies to the
SPIN-ORBIT energy for any centralized potential
VC. Relativist motion always causes an
effective B-like force. The above equation is
expected to apply to a non-Coulomb force
provided it is central
To find the energy of the atom one must of course
take an average over the atom

Switching to the nucleus
Even for large A and large l one is not going to
get a big splitting. This was not able to change
the magic numbers. Mayer, Jensen, Haxel and
Suess knew this they had done this calculation
it had no effect on the magic numbers. What
they discovered was that this relativistic Spin
Orbit energy was being swamped by another
Spin-Orbit energy that was coming from a
non-relativistic source.
10
The spin-orbit effect comes from the nuclear
surface not the bulk
The reason is that the strong spin direction
forces are matched by equal and opposite forces
in the center of the nucleus. On the surface
nucleons can only pass the shown nucleon in one
direction only.
